Baku hosts Congress of International Canoe Federation

The 36th Congress of the International Canoe Federation (ICF) has begun in Baku, bringing together more than 200 delegates from 89 countries.

ICF President Jose Perurena Lopez opened the Congress.

President of the Azerbaijan National Rowing Federation, Elchin Zeynalov, said the country was proud to host the Congress. He also highlighted accomplishments of Azerbaijani rowers at international events, including at Olympic Games.

The event will feature the election of the president and vice presidents of the International Canoe Federation, as well as chairpersons responsible for canoe sprint, canoe slalom and canoe-marathon.

The member federations will also review a report on the implementation of the ICF's 2016-2020 development program, and consider proposals of the Board of Directors, Executive Committee and the national federations.
